Good morning everyone,

I just got sleeved on October 12. I have no pain at all but I'm struggling to get in all of my Protein and 64oz of h2o. I get full so quick and all Protein shakes taste funny to me. I purchased an unflavored Protein powder that I found at Walmart but it makes everything I put it in like a milky color and has a funny after taste.... any advice on how I can get in my protein and fluids. Also did anyone else experience coughing up phlegm and a little blood?? Mines finally stopped but just wondering if anyone else experienced the same.

You need to add flavorings to the shakes, although I do like Premier chocolate remade shakes in the carton. You will hear about Torani SF syrups, Dasani flavored drops, even adding a little SF pudding, low sugar yogurts, even Crystal Light powder.

You need to remember there are no medical experts here so if you see blood or have pain, go to the ER or call your doctor. Trust your gut instinct about your body!

Congrats! I am 5 days out and had the same problems :( My doctor gave me a recipe that is WONDERFUL! It gives you the same Protein in 1/2 the amount and makes more time available for getting in your Water.

1-sugar free pudding (in ready container)

1-scoop of Protein Powder

A little milk (about 1/3 cup)

Blend well.

It will become a liquid and is 1/2 the amount of a shake with the same amount of Protein. Best part is you can change up pudding flavor (as long as it's sugar free) so you don't get bored with the taste. Hope this helps!

I tried a lot of drinks to get my Water in - Powerade zero, g2, infused lemon Water, Vitamin water zero. Tart things worst best, I've found fake sugar tastes even more sickly sweet. Buy 1 or 2 of each and just keep trying them. I'm a month out and still figuring that part out.

I found the ocean spray diet cranberry, with a scoop of Protein powder pretty tolerable at that stage. It made the juice almost taste creamy. Sounds gross but it helped me a ton. And sugar free popsicles. Popsicle brand has a Tropical variety that was such a nice change from the standard cherry, grape, orange. Good luck. I am 2 1/2 weeks out and still struggle to get 65 oz of liquid in. Everyday is New day.
